Buddha, a grade I winner by Unbridled's Song  , has arrived for stallion stud at Dr. William J. Solomon's Pin Oak Lane Farm near New Freedom, Pa. He formerly stood at John Sikura's Hill 'n' Dale Farms near Lexington. His 2008 fee is $5,000.

In 2007, Buddha was represented by stakes winners Buddha Lady, Glorification, and Hisse. His progeny earnings of $1,789,036 last year placed him among Pennsylvania's leading sires. A 9-year-old, Buddha also is the sire of three stakes-placed runners, including grade III-placed Lenaro.

Buddha won all three of his starts at 3, including the Wood Memorial Stakes (gr. I). He is out of the Storm Catmare Cahooters and his third dam is a half-sister to the great Damascus.
